About Inc. and the Inc. 500/5000
The 2014 Inc. 5000 is ranked according to percentage revenue growth when comparing 2010 to 2013. To qualify, companies must have been founded and generating revenue by March 31, 2010. They had to be U.S.-based, privately held, for profit and independent—not subsidiaries or divisions of other companies—as of December 31, 2013. (Since then, a number of companies on the list have gone public or been acquired.) The minimum revenue for 2010 is $100,000; the minimum for 2013 is $2 million. About Pentec Health, Inc.
For over 30 years, Pentec Health has been an industry leader in providing physician prescribed, custom prepared, patient-specific sterile medications that are intended for patient administration in the home as well as various alternate administration sites. Pentec Health is focused on providing renal nutritional products and services to dialysis centers for their malnourished dialysis patients, and as a Joint Commission accredited home care provider, the company offers in-home infusion services for highly complex conditions that are underserved by traditional home care providers.
